OK Everyone Time to fess up on quick tricks you use...I'll start
Did you know you could take Copic pens and color white scrappers floss with it so you can customize it. Probably works with other pens as well but i am Copic converty. BTW That idea gets a shout out to Danni!!!
Also did you know you could take Copics and color a Bella String of Pearls bauble (Yes I sell them hee hee) and get a glimmery neat bauble that you can once again customize. Let it dry over night before handling as it does need some dry time :o)
The string of pearls is best as it has that pearl effect to it and is brighter to let the color show thru well.
